[Diagnosis and differential diagnostics of acute and emergency psychiatric situations].

P Neu1.   

Abstract

Psychiatric emergency situations are common, not only in psychiatric clinics but also in other medical disciplines or the general emergency room. It is crucial for every medical doctor to be able to recognize acute psychiatric symptoms and appreciate them as parts of different medical conditions. This article presents six important acute psychiatric symptoms with reference to the underlying differential diagnosis.
